- Sujet
- Light chain 3 (LC3) is a microtubule-associated protein with an approximate molecular mass of 17 kDa, and can be found ubiquitously throughout mammalian tissue. LC3 plays a role in autophagy, once the autophagic process is initiated in a cell, LC3 is conjugated to phosphatidylethanolamine to form LC3-II. This molecule is recruited to the autophagosome at the time of fusion with lysosomes, and LC3-II in autolysosomal lumen is degraded. Therefore, monitoring LC3 is an important tool for detecting autophagy and autophagy-related processes. LC3A is one of three isoforms which exhibits abundant expression in the heart, brain, liver, skeletal muscle, and testis but is absent in thymus and peripheral blood leukocytes.
